The Tanjung Enim DME project stalled in 2023 after Air Products withdrew. It has now been restarted under Danantara with MIND ID, Bukit Asam, and Pertamina.
Malaysia's biodiesel industry produced 975,207 metric tonnes in 2025 against 2.36 million metric tonnes of installed capacity, leaving room for immediate mandate-driven scale-up.
Qatar's supply disruptions account for around 10% of Singapore's natural gas. Generators are replacing those volumes at higher cost. The bill reaches households in July.
